Q3 Planning Note — Franchise Agreement

Branch managers: the franchise agreement with Tollgate Provisions has been finalized for the Easthollow territory. Onboarding begins mid-quarter, with training led by Ruben Castile. Inventory allocations shift accordingly; expect revised order schedules within two weeks. Please hold questions until the briefing. The confidential strategic note is attached directly below.

confidential, tagag-kahof: Rusathox Partners plans to lower the Gorox list price by 63 percent in December.

**Q: Why do the turnstile counts at Varkell Arena look off after halftime?**

Short answer: the GateTally units batch their pings, so counts lag by up to four minutes during peak flow. Don't panic if the dashboard dips — it catches up. If numbers stay flat for 10+ minutes, a unit probably dropped off the mesh. The reset steps and per-gate health view live on the internal page below.

wiki page, hahif-hahif: https://argocd.kelvisys.corp/browse/board/settings/pages/1442e0b1065d83f1

# EXIF scrubber for Mirelight upload pipeline.
# Strips GPS, serial, and timestamp tags from user images before they hit
# the public CDN buckets. Runs inline on upload; on failure the image is
# quarantined, never published. On-call: if the quarantine queue backs up,
# check the worker pool size before touching timeouts — scrubbing is CPU
# bound, not I/O bound. Do not disable scrubbing to clear a backlog.
# Current production constants follow.

tuning table, yajog-yahof:
BUDGETS = {
    "lamvan": 303,
    "wenox": 460,
    "fenvan": 525,
}

Handover — Vexler partner SFTP drop

Ownership moves to you today. Drop runs hourly from Vexler's end into the intake bucket via the relay host. Watch for zero-byte files; their exporter flakes on Mondays. Creds live in the ops vault, path noted in the runbook. Vault auto-seals after 48h idle. Support escalations go to the on-call rotation, not me. If the vault is sealed when you need it, unseal with the recovery passphrase below.

recovery phrase for tadug-fafof: zorwyn-kasion